Kids Love Greece has selected the top six archaeological sites and museums that should not be missed on any family visit to Greece. All you need is your camera to capture those once in a life time moments and impress your friends back home, not to mention the teacher of course!

Tip for the family photo: pose in front of the Parthenon and say ‘CHEESE’. Surely this snapshot will deserve a worthy place on the mantelpiece in your living room.

Tip for the family photo: say ‘CHEESE’ under the Caryatids columns which prominently dominate inside the museum.
NATIONAL ARCHAEOLOGICAL MUSEUM-Athens

Tip for the family photo: say “Cheese” next to the huge and impressive statue of Kouros which is 3 meters in height.

Tip for the family photo: say ‘CHEESE’ as you stand beside the large bronze statue of the Charioteer of Delphi.
PALACE OF KNOSSOS–Heraklion, Crete
Tip for the family photo: say ‘CHEESE’ as you stand in front of the fresco ‘Prince of the Lilies’ or ‘The Blue Ladies’.
ARCHAEOLOGICAL MUSEUM–Heraklion, Crete

Tip for the family photo: say ‘CHEESE’ next to Phaistos Disc. Put your archaeologist-explorer hat on and try to solve the mystery!
